Govt. of Maharashtra issued Clarification on the taxability of shares held in a subsidiary company by the holding company

Finance & Taxation ComplianceThe Government of Maharashtra on July 21, 2023, issued a notification regarding the taxability of shares held in a subsidiary company by the holding company.

This has a reference to the CBIC Circular No.  196/08/2023-GST related to Clarification on the taxability of shares held in a subsidiary company by the holding company

The following has been clarified namely: -

• The Taxability of share capital held in the subsidiary company by the parent company has been clarified as follows namely: -

It states that the activity of holding of shares of a subsidiary company by the holding company per se cannot be treated as a supply of services by a holding company to the said subsidiary company and cannot be taxed under GST.

 

[Circular No. 16 T 0f 2023]
